Как гарантируется корректность работы приложений
Правильность работы приложений выступает ключевым требованием к любому информационному сервису. Независимо от размера проекта — от компактного служебного инструмента вплоть до многоуровневой распределенной архитектуры — приложение необходимо чтобы исполнять заявленные операции надежно, предсказуемо и без ошибок результата. Поддержание корректности не заканчивается написанием рабочего кода. Подобный подход вулкан россия системный механизм, охватывающий проектирование, проверку, контроль данных, отслеживание и непрерывную обслуживание, что глубоко анализируется в экспертных обзорах казино вулкан.
Приложение функционирует в заданной среде: базовая платформа, технические мощности, инфраструктурное окружение, сторонние сервисы. Любое даже незначительное обновление этих параметров способно изменить на логику приложения. Вследствие этого устойчивость понимается не только как отсутствие сбоев в логике, одновременно и как способность программы обеспечивать стабильность при разнообразных условиях работы.
Формализация ожиданий а также проектное описание
Обеспечение стабильности начинается задолго прежде чем написания алгоритма. На самом первом этапе разрабатывается проектное описание, где фиксируются функции системы, сценарии использования, пределы а также предполагаемые результаты. Ясно зафиксированные критерии позволяют исключить расхождений и смысловых расхождений в проектировании.
Важно определить граничные сценарии, нестандартные режимы и разрешенные отклонения. В случае если критерии сохраняются нечеткими, стабильность превращается условной характеристикой. Структурирование показателей делает осуществимой объективную проверку выполнения программы ожиданиям вулкан россии.
Помимо этого разрабатываются функциональные модели и схемы процессов, описывающие логику операций в рамках приложения. Такие модели дают возможность выявлять структурные ошибки ещё до начала программирования а также корректировать логику разрабатываемого продукта.
Разработка организации и каркаса программы
Грамотно выстроенная архитектура заметно уменьшает вероятность ошибок. Разделение программы на самостоятельные модули, реализация принципов инкапсуляции а также минимизация переплетений между компонентами повышают устойчивость программы. Изолированные компоненты легче анализировать а также изменять без разрушения глобальной архитектуры.
Ясная организация кода ускоряет обслуживание и аудит. Внедрение понятных обозначений переменных vulkan russia, а также придерживание стандартизированных правил реализации снижает вероятность латентных структурных сбоев.
Существенным преимуществом является способность масштабирования проекта. В случае если модули системы независимы, их можно модифицировать одновременно, поддерживая глобальную стабильность приложения.
Статический разбор и проверка программы
Непосредственно перед внедрения программы в использование проводится проверка реализации. Автоматизированный разбор находит потенциальные уязвимости, нарушения правил и некорректные участки. Специализированные средства вулкан россия позволяют фиксировать частые ошибки на начальном этапе.
Ревью кода со стороны других разработчиков даёт возможность распознать логические неточности, что способны оказаться скрытыми для автора реализации. Совместная проверка увеличивает качество программы и поддерживает согласованность архитектурных решений.
В ходе аудита параллельно анализируется читаемость и расширяемость кода, что критично для долгосрочной эксплуатации и избежания роста архитектурных дефектов.
Многоуровневое валидация
Валидация является ключевым способом подтверждения правильности. Юнит проверки вулкан россии проверяют изолированные методы, связующие — согласованность среди частями, сквозные — поведение программы в полном объеме. Такой поэтапный подход поддерживает комплексную проверку корректности.
Повышенное внимание приобретают тесты на граничные условия а также необычные сценарии. Ошибки нередко возникают в работе с максимальными данными, при отсутствии входных значений а также в нестандартных типах исходной данных.
Дополнительно используются повторные испытания, которые позволяют подтвердить, что обновленные правки не сломали ранее части приложения. Это vulkan russia гарантирует корректность в ходе обновления решения.
Валидация поступающих значений
Приложение обязана корректно интерпретировать исходные данные независимо от их формирования. Проверка формата, диапазона параметров и required полей предотвращает проведение неверных операций. Проверка защищает систему от логических ошибок а также нестабильного поведения.
Кроме того, критично обеспечить защиту от намеренно некорректных данных. Очистка и контроль формата входных параметров исключают искажение целостности системы.
Системная ревизия корректности информации вулкан россия помогает поддерживать стабильность процессов вычислений и укрепляет достоверность выходов исполнения системы.
Управление исключений
Даже детальном тестировании абсолютно исключить проявление ошибок невозможно. В связи с этим приложение необходимо чтобы реализовывать механизмы контроля аварийных ситуаций. В случае возникновении сбоя программа необходимо чтобы либо безопасно завершить выполнение, либо переключиться в контролируемое режим.
Фиксация исключений помогает разбирать факторы нарушений а также исправлять подобные случаи в последующих обновлениях. Отсутствие эффективной механики обработки ошибок в состоянии вызвать к цепным отказам в функционировании программы.
Понятные сообщения вулкан россии об сбоях позволяют оперативнее выявлять проблемы и облегчают сопровождение системы.
Контроль устойчивости
Надежность подразумевает не лишь точность результатов, одновременно и устойчивость выполнения в реальных условиях. Программа обязана адекватно работать при изменяющихся уровнях активности, не вызывая перерасхода памяти, блокировок либо ухудшения производительности.
Стрессовое проверка помогает обнаружить узкие точки и проанализировать реакцию приложения при экстремальной нагрузке запросов. Рационализация алгоритмов гарантирует предсказуемость работы в продолжительной работе.
Постоянный анализ производительности помогает оперативно фиксировать признаки снижения эффективности и избегать сбои.
Мониторинг после внедрения
Даже развертывания программы требуется непрерывный надзор. Отслеживание позволяет контролировать ключевые показатели: количество ошибок, скорость ответа, расход процессора. Разбор таких показателей помогает своевременно выявлять отклонения.
Своевременное устранение при аномальные показатели исключает развитие серьёзных отказов а также обеспечивает корректность исполнения в боевых условиях vulkan russia.
Параллельно используются механизмы уведомлений, которые позволяют уведомлять специалистов о важных отклонениях в реальном реального момента.
Отслеживание изменений
Эволюция приложения закономерно связано с внесением изменений. Внедрение систем отслеживания кода даёт возможность записывать все правку и контролировать их воздействие на функциональность. Такая практика облегчает восстановление к рабочему версии в обнаружении ошибок.
Постепенное реализация версий и непременное проверка новой сборки позволяют обеспечивать целостность системы и снизить критических сбоев.
Журнал обновлений выступает основой анализа модификаций системы и даёт возможность выявлять хронические проблемы.
Защищенность как составляющая стабильности
Ослабление контроля доступа может привести к искажению данных и некорректной функционированию системы. Поэтому обеспечение безопасности от несанкционированного вмешательства, управление прав аккаунтов а также системное обновление библиотек являются основой обеспечения стабильности вулкан россия.
Шифрование и мониторинг сетевых снижают сторонние атаки, которые повлиять работу приложения.
Регулярные аудиты безопасности позволяют фиксировать слабые места до того, если эти проблемы приведут к серьёзным последствиям.
Сопровождение
Структурированная документация ускоряет сопровождение приложения и уменьшает вероятность ошибок при доработке. Документирование логики функционирования позволяет подключающимся специалистам эффективно ориентироваться в кодовой базе системы.
Постоянное актуализация документации гарантирует соответствие фактическому версии программы и обеспечивает корректность в процессе её эволюции.
Грамотно структурированные описания кроме того облегчают освоение новых модулей вулкан россии и упрощают обучение специалистов.
Итог
Стабильность работы приложений обеспечивается многоуровневым процессом, содержащим четкую описание условий, структурированную структуру, тестирование, мониторинг и контроль обновлениями. Подобная система vulkan russia служит долгосрочным циклом, охватывающим полный жизненный цикл системы.
Именно сочетание программной аккуратности, комплексного анализа и постоянного наблюдения даёт возможность обеспечивать стабильность цифровых систем в условиях развивающейся реальности.